Registrierung Mitgliederliste Administratoren und Moderatoren Suche Häufig gestellte Fragen Zur Startseite  

DsChAeK Forum » Suche » Suchergebnis » Hallo Gast [anmelden|registrieren]
Zeige Themen 1 bis 7 von 7 Treffern
Autor Beitrag
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

16.09.2008 10:33 Forum: Fehler/Probleme und Fragen

ET GEEEEHT - ISCH WERD VERÃœCKT!!!!

so - jetztz muss ich ma gucken das es reproduzierbar wird - sprich mit der neuen api.sh, wlan uswusf. ausprobieren.
Wenn alles zuverlässig funkzt schreib ich mal ne kurze Zusammenfassung/Tutorial ....

DsChAek - youre the man!!!

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

16.09.2008 00:25 Forum: Fehler/Probleme und Fragen

Hab jetzt nochmal die "originale" api.sh aus "dbox-streaming-api.zip" auf die Box kopiert
und dann manuell das script ausgeführt. Bekomme jetzt tatsächlich die "korrekte" Ausgabe (siehe unten).
Mein herumpfuschen in der Datei mit Notepad hat dann doch üble Folgen gehabt....

Das Problem besteht aber weiterhin - ein Aufruf von http://192.168.178.4/control/exec?api+version in meinem Browser ergibt keinen $Revision: 1.1 $ oder ähnliches.

Ich hab mir nochmal das Script angeschaut, die einzig relative Pfadangabe ist ja der + path_httpd=..
Kann es sein das ich api.sh im falschen Verzeichniss abgelegt habe, bzw. was bedeutet + path_httpd=..

/share/tuxbox/neutrino/httpd/scripts # sh -x api.sh
+ API_VERSION=1.0
+ path_httpd=..
+ path_scripts=../scripts
+ path_usrbin=/var/bin
+ path_config=/var/tuxbox/config
+ path_tmp=/tmp
+ streaming_client_status=/tmp/streaming_client
+ echo [api.sh] Parameter wrong:
[api.sh] Parameter wrong:

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

15.09.2008 19:26 Forum: Fehler/Probleme und Fragen

Hallo -

werde ich später am Abend wenn ich wieder Zugriff auf meine Box habe, mal mit einem vernünftige Editor ausprobieren.

Noch eine Verständnissfrage:

dboxTV ruft die api.sh über lan auf -> das script initialisiert den Prozess udpstreamts -> der wiederum den stream an vlc liefert

, oder ?

Grüße und schon mal Danke für den tollen Support....


ranX

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

15.09.2008 15:38 Forum: Fehler/Probleme und Fragen

http://192.168.178.4/control/exec?api+version

ergibt keine Ausgabe im Browser.




Hab jetzt mal folgendes probiert:



Per telnet auf die box

und mit

sh -x api.sh

das script manuell ausgeführt.

Ich bekomme folgende Meldung:

+ API_VERSION_MAJOR=1
+ API_VERSION_MINOR=0
.0API_VERSION_TEXT=1
+ path_httpd=..
/scriptscripts=..
+ path_usrbin=/var/bin
+ path_sbin=/sbin
+ path_config=/var/tuxbox/config
+ path_tmp=/tmp
+
: not found.sh: 17:
/streaming_clientt_status=/tmp
+
: not found.sh: 19:
+ {
: not found.sh: 23: {
+ up=no
api.sh: api.sh: 33: Syntax error: word unexpected (expecting "in")



Ich werde heute abend mal die unmodifizierte Version ausprobieren......

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

15.09.2008 13:18 Forum: Fehler/Probleme und Fragen

>Wenn du manuell mit VLC testen willst, dann mußt du zuerst VLC starten und danach "udp_stream start" ausführen


Wie kann ich in VLC "udp_stream start" ausführen? Über die VLC Konsole ist es mir nicht gelungen....

(sorry - bin absoluter VLC-Noob)

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

15.09.2008 13:10 Forum: Fehler/Probleme und Fragen

Hallo -

Die IP ist korrekt, http streaming funktioniert ja auch.

Das Problem ist glaube ich eher die api.sh und udpstreamts auf meiner Dbox.
Die Datei udpstreamts ist beim glj-image ursprünglich im Verzeichniss /sbin vorhanden, jedoch nur 6864 KB groß.
Api.sh hab ich nicht finden können.


Ich habe deswegen die gefixte Version von neutrinotv.homeip.net runtergeladen und api.sh und udpstreamts manuell installiert.

Ich habe

api.sh nach /var/httdp/scripts kopiert

udpstreamts nach /var/bin kopiert, wobei /bin nur als link im/var Verzeichniss existiert.


Die Zugriffsrechte sind folgenermaßen vergeben:
-rwxr-xr-x 1 0 0 2058 Sep 12 13:52 api.sh
-rwxr-xr-x 1 0 0 16787 Sep 12 13:53 udpstreamts


Hier noch mein Dboxtv log nach Umschalten von http auf udp streaming:


[General]
mode=live
ip_pc=192.168.178.20
ip_inet=
broadcastport_udp=31329
streamport_prov=31328
server_port=31327
streamtype=http
priority=NORMAL
sleep_function=Power Off
osdshowtime=5000
dbox_anz=1
providestream=0
compressstream=0
rememberstate=1
autospts=0
fullscreen=0
lock_rc=0
hide_taskbar=0
hide_cursor_on_fs=0
show_message=0
telnet_autologin=0
check_record=0
no_logging=0
no_epgdata=0
no_record_playback=1
use_recm_on_subchannel=1
choose_box_on_start=0
videoonly_noborder=0
draganddrop=1
autoradiorestart=0
disablehotkeys=0
dbox_index=0

[D-Box2_0]
dbox_name=D-Box2
dbox_ip=192.168.178.4
dbox_port=80
dbox_user=hidden :)
dbox_pass=hidden :)
telnet_port=23
telnet_user=hidden :)
telnet_pass=hidden :)
telnet_nhttpd=nhttpd

[VLC]
libvlcdll=
vlcip=192.168.178.20
vlcport=8080
vlcuser=hidden :)
vlcpass=hidden :)
streamport_udp=31330
vlc_rc_port=100
vlc_http_port=120
cacheonline=3000
cachelive=1000
vlc_deinterlace=3
vlc_output=0
vlc_visualize=0
vlc_high_prio=1
online_all_audio_ch=0
timeshift=0
timeshift_path=c:\
timeshift_filesize=50

[Online Stream]
vcodec=h264
vbitrate=400
vscale=0.3
vwidth=0
vheight=0
vfps=0,00
acodec=mp3
abitrate=64
achannels=2

[VLC Record]
record_raw=0
file_syntax=%T_%C_%P_-_%I
record_all_audio_ch=1
record_comp_tv=0
record_comp_radio=1
record_path=I:\dboxrec
vcodec=DIV3
vbitrate=2048
vscale=0,50
vwidth=0
vheight=0
acodec=mp3
abitrate=128
achannels=2
mux_tv=MPEG TS
mux_radio=RAW
ts=ts
mp3=mp3

[Advanced]
delay_zapto=0
delay_afterosdshot=800
delay_afterosdcmd=800
delay_betweenepgdata=2000
delay_aftervlcpause=0
delay_aftervlcstop=200
delay_aftervlcbasestart=300
delay_aftervlcaddtarget=150
timeout_http=12000
timeout_telnet=2000
thread_updateallradio=10
thread_updatecurrradio=3
menu_break=30

[Window]
monitor=0
height=390
width=398
left=458
top=111
alwaysontop=0
videoonly=0
volume=50
___________________________________________________________________________
____________________________________________

13:13:09:187, FUNC , Ping: 192.168.178.4
13:13:09:203, FUNC , Ping Status: No error(0)
13:13:09:312, STATE , getting dbox time...
13:13:09:312, HTTP , http://192.168.178.4:80/control/gettime?rawtime,
13:13:09:828, HTTP , http://192.168.178.4:80/control/system?getAViAExtPlayBack, no error
13:13:09:890, HTTP , http://192.168.178.4:80/control/getmode, no error
13:13:09:953, STATE , loading bouquets...
13:13:09:953, HTTP , http://192.168.178.4:80/control/getbouquetsxml, no error
13:13:10:093, HTTP , http://192.168.178.4:80/control/getservicesxml, no error
13:13:12:781, HTTP , http://192.168.178.4:80/control/zapto, no error
13:13:12:843, HTTP , http://192.168.178.4:80/control/epg?ext, no error
13:13:17:468, STATE , initializing vlc...
13:13:17:734, VLC , VLC_Init(vlc_base), no error
13:13:18:062, VLC , VLC_Init(vlc_record), no error
13:13:18:406, VLC , VLC_Init(vlc_provide), no error
13:13:18:734, VLC , VLC_Init(vlc_custom), no error
13:13:19:015, VLC , VLC_Init(vlc_play), no error
13:13:19:031, STATE , switching channel...
13:13:19:031, FUNC , SwitchChannel(08. RTL Television)
13:13:19:031, FUNC , SetDboxMode(TV)
13:13:19:031, FUNC , getting subchannels...
13:13:19:031, HTTP , http://192.168.178.4:80/control/zapto?getallsubchannels, no error
13:13:19:140, STATE , getting streaminfo...
13:13:19:140, HTTP , http://192.168.178.4:80/control/info?streaminfo, no error
13:13:19:187, HTTP , http://192.168.178.4:80/control/zapto?getallpids, no error
13:13:19:312, FUNC , LiveURL: http://192.168.178.4:31339/0,0x002C,0x00A3,0x0068,0x006A
13:13:19:312, FUNC , AspectRatio: 4:3
13:13:19:312, FUNC , PrepareAndStartStream()
13:13:19:312, VLC , VLC_PlaylistClear(), no error
13:13:19:312, VLC , Play (vlc_base): http://192.168.178.4:31339/0,0x002C,0x00A3,0x0068,0x006A, no error
13:13:19:312, FUNC , Delay 150ms
13:13:19:468, FUNC , Delay 300ms
13:13:19:781, FUNC , Delay 150ms
13:13:19:937, VLC , VLC_MRL_base: :sout=#duplicate{dst=std{access=http,mux=ts,dst=192.168.178.20:31339}}, no error
13:13:19:937, VLC , VLC_MRL_local: , no error
13:13:19:937, VLC , VLC_MRL_online: , no error
13:13:19:937, VLC , Play (vlc_play): http://192.168.178.20:31339, no error
13:13:21:140, STATE , caching...(1000ms)
13:13:22:156, STATE , playing HTTP stream...(720x576/1875kbit/joint stereo)
13:13:22:156, FUNC , switching time : 3.125s
13:13:29:718, STATE , switching channel...
13:13:29:718, FUNC , SwitchChannel(08. RTL Television)
13:13:29:718, FUNC , Stop()
13:13:29:718, VLC , VLC_Pause(vlc_play), no error
13:13:29:734, VLC , VLC_Stop(vlc_play), no error
13:13:29:734, VLC , VLC_Pause(vlc_base), no error
13:13:29:750, VLC , VLC_Stop(vlc_base), no error
13:13:29:750, FUNC , Delay 200ms
13:13:30:156, HTTP , http://192.168.178.4:80/control/exec?api udp_stream stop, no error
13:13:30:296, FUNC , Delay 200ms
13:13:30:500, VLC , VLC_PlaylistClear(), no error
13:13:30:500, FUNC , SetDboxMode(TV)
13:13:30:500, FUNC , getting subchannels...
13:13:30:500, HTTP , http://192.168.178.4:80/control/zapto?getallsubchannels, no error
13:13:30:593, STATE , getting streaminfo...
13:13:30:593, HTTP , http://192.168.178.4:80/control/info?streaminfo, no error
13:13:30:656, HTTP , http://192.168.178.4:80/control/zapto?getallpids, no error
13:13:30:781, FUNC , LiveURL:http://192.168.178.4:80/control/exec?api udp_stream start 192.168.178.20 31330 0 0x002C 0x00A3
13:13:30:781, FUNC , AspectRatio: 4:3
13:13:30:781, FUNC , PrepareAndStartStream()
13:13:30:781, VLC , VLC_PlaylistClear(), no error
13:13:30:781, VLC , Play (vlc_base): udp://@192.168.178.20:31330, no error
13:13:30:781, FUNC , Delay 150ms
13:13:30:937, FUNC , Delay 300ms
13:13:31:406, HTTP , http://192.168.178.4:80/control/exec?api udp_stream start 192.168.178.20 31330 0 0x002C 0x00A3 0x0068 0x006A, no error
13:13:31:406, FUNC , Delay 150ms
13:13:31:562, VLC , VLC_MRL_base: :sout=#duplicate{dst=std{access=http,mux=ts,dst=192.168.178.20:31339}}, no error
13:13:31:562, VLC , VLC_MRL_local: , no error
13:13:31:562, VLC , VLC_MRL_online: , no error
13:13:31:562, VLC , Play (vlc_play): http://192.168.178.20:31339, no error
13:13:32:765, STATE , caching...(1000ms)
13:13:33:781, STATE , playing UDP stream...(720x576/1875kbit/joint stereo)
13:13:33:781, FUNC , switching time : 4.63s
13:13:35:390, FUNC , Stop()
13:13:35:390, VLC , VLC_Pause(vlc_play), no error
13:13:35:406, VLC , VLC_Stop(vlc_play), no error
13:13:35:406, VLC , VLC_Pause(vlc_base), no error
13:13:35:421, VLC , VLC_Stop(vlc_base), no error
13:13:35:421, FUNC , Delay 200ms
13:13:35:828, HTTP , http://192.168.178.4:80/control/exec?api udp_stream stop, no error
13:13:35:968, FUNC , Delay 200ms
13:13:36:171, STATE , stream stopped!
13:13:36:171, STATE , no stream available!
13:13:36:171, VLC , IsAfterSwitchChannel, no playback! , no error
13:14:06:312, STATE , shutting down...
13:14:06:312, FUNC , StopEPGThread()
13:14:06:343, FUNC , Stop()
13:14:06:343, VLC , VLC_Pause(vlc_play), no error
13:14:06:343, VLC , VLC_Stop(vlc_play), no error
13:14:06:343, VLC , VLC_Pause(vlc_base), no error
13:14:06:343, VLC , VLC_Stop(vlc_base), no error
13:14:06:343, FUNC , Delay 200ms
13:14:06:343, HTTP , http://192.168.178.4:80/control/exec?api udp_stream stop, no error
13:14:06:343, FUNC , Delay 200ms
13:14:06:343, STATE , stream stopped!
13:14:06:546, VLC , VLC_Die(), no error
13:14:06:546, STATE , free memory
13:14:06:562, STATE , byebye!

Thema: [gelöst] Problem UDP Live Streaming von GLJ Image zu DBOXTV
ranXeron

Antworten: 12
Hits: 21341

Problem UDP Live Streaming von GLJ Image zu DBOXTV 12.09.2008 13:18 Forum: Fehler/Probleme und Fragen

Hallo -

habe mit meiner neu geflashten Box (aktuelles GLJ Full Sat 2x Image) folgendes Problem:

Ãœbers Webinterface funktioniert sowohl normales ( http ) als auch highspeed ( udp ) Streaming problemlos.
HTTP Streaming -> Ard / ORF etc ruckeln, jedoch bei übers Webinterface eingeschaltetem Highspeed Streaming alles bestens...

Nun würde ich aber gerne als Live Streaming Client im LAN Dbox TV nutzten.
Das "normale" http-streaming funktioniert einwandfrei, schaltet man jedoch auf UDP Streaming kommt die Fehlermeldung " no stream available ".
Windows XP firewall ist für UDP Port 31330 geöffnet, GLJ wird mit SPTS Treiber gebootet und VLC funktioniert im Webinterface auch klaglos im Highspeed (UDP) Modus.

Rufe ich jedoch im VLC über den Streaming Assistenten udp://@:31330 auf, führt
das auch zu keinem Ergebniss bzw.Stream.

Wenn ich alles richtig verstanden habe ist fürs UDP Streaming das script api.sh und udpstreamts zuständig.
Wodurch wird dieser Prozess initialisiert, und wo müssen im GLJ Image die Dateien liegen, so das Sie von DboxTV gefunden werden?

( bzw. wat mach ich falsch oder wie oder was.... )




Schon mal 1000fachen Dank für Eure Hilfe... (und das suuuper Programm!!!)



dboxTV: dboxTV v2.0.1.1
Boxtyp: Nokia D-Box2 (SAT)
Image: GLJ Full Image 06.09.2008
yWeb: -
nhttpd: ?
vlc: VLC v0.8.6i Janus mit "alter" libvlc.dll
OS: WinXP SP3

Zeige Themen 1 bis 7 von 7 Treffern

Powered by Burning Board Lite 1.0.2 © 2001-2004 WoltLab GmbH